1. Comprehending Key Programming
Key programming is the process of configuring a vehicle's key or key fob to communicate with the car's immobilizer system. Modern lorries often have sophisticated security features that employ advanced technology to avoid theft. This security is largely reliant on the programming of keys and key fobs.
1.1 Types of Automotive Keys
There are a number of kinds of keys utilized in modern vehicles. Understanding these types is crucial for both consumers and automotive professionals:

Traditional Mechanical Keys: These keys are by hand cut to fit the vehicle's ignition lock. They do not include electronic elements.

Transponder Keys: These keys contain a chip that interacts with the vehicle's onboard computer system. When the key is inserted, the car confirms the signal before permitting the engine to start.

Remote Keyless Entry (RKE) Keys: Often described as "key fobs," these gadgets permit the user to unlock and start the vehicle without placing a physical key into the ignition.

Smart Keys: These innovative keys permit keyless entry and ignition. The vehicle detects the presence of the smart key, enabling the chauffeur to start the engine with the push of a button.

The Key Programming Process
The key programming procedure can vary depending on the kind of key, vehicle make and design, and producer. Nevertheless, it generally includes a number of key steps:
2.1 Preparing the Vehicle
Before starting the programming procedure, it is vital to:
Ensure the vehicle is in a location complimentary from obstructions.Have all necessary keys present for programming (if appropriate).Disconnect any previous keys or fobs from the vehicle's memory.2.2 Programming Steps
While the precise process might vary, the following steps provide a basic standard for key programming:

Accessing the Vehicle's ECU: Connect a programming tool or key programmer to the vehicle's On-Board Diagnostics (OBD-II) port.

Picking the Programming Feature: Use the programming tool to find and choose the key programming feature in the vehicle's ECU.

Going Into Key Information: Input the appropriate key details as prompted by the programming tool.

Validating Programming: Follow the programming tool's instructions to validate if the key has actually been successfully programmed.

Testing the [key programming And codes](https://www.carloslimes.top/automotive/transponder-car-key-programming-a-comprehensive-guide/): After programming, test the key or fob to guarantee it runs all needed performances, including locking/unlocking doors and starting the engine.
2.3 Common Tools Used
Mechanics and automotive experts often count on specialized tools to assist in key programming:

OBD-II Key Programmers: Devices that link to the vehicle's OBD-II port to program keys straight through the ECU.

Committed Key Programming Devices: Standalone units designed particularly for key programming across multiple vehicle makes and models.

Manufacturer-Specific Diagnostic Tools: Tools developed by vehicle manufacturers that offer sophisticated programming abilities.
3. Regularly Asked Questions (FAQs)3.1 How long does it take to program a key?
The time required to program a key can differ commonly. Easy programming tasks can frequently be completed in 5-10 minutes, while more intricate processes might take up to an hour.
3.2 Can I program a key myself?
Sometimes, vehicle owners can program their keys using guidelines from user manuals or online resources. However, certain designs may need an expert service technician.
3.3 What should I do if I lose all my keys?
If all keys are lost, a certified locksmith or dealer may need to reprogram the vehicle's ECU and provide new keys. This procedure can be more costly and time-consuming than programming additional keys.
3.4 Is it required to reprogram a key after a battery modification in my key fob?
In many cases, changing the battery in a key fob does not require reprogramming. Nevertheless, if the fob stops working to work after a battery modification, it may need to be reprogrammed.
